How MCMXCVI is formed

M1000
CM900
XC90
V5
I1

M + CM + XC + V + I = 1000 + 900 + 90 + 5 + 1 = 1996.

Where MCMXCVI is used

A year numeral turns up in different places from a bare number. These are the four that send people looking for MCMXCVI.

  • Date tattoos and engravings. A year-only piece is just MCMXCVI, and a full date stacks the day and month above it. MCMXCVI is 7 characters long, which matters more than people expect: it sets how wide the bottom line of a stacked date will sit.
  • Copyright lines in credits. Film and television end credits have long set the copyright year in Roman numerals, so a production from 1996 carries MCMXCVI on its end card. If you are reading a numeral off a title sequence rather than writing one, this is usually the one you have found.
  • Cornerstones and dedications. Buildings, monuments and foundation stones carry their year in numerals, which is why MCMXCVI turns up carved rather than typed. Every year between 1900 and 1999 opens with MCM, so on a datestone it is the letters after MCM that tell you which year you are actually looking at.
  • Anniversaries. In 2026, a date from 1996 is 30 years old, so MCMXCVI is the numeral for a 30th anniversary this year. Wedding and birth years are the two most common reasons to want MCMXCVI written correctly.

How do you write the year 1996 in Roman numerals?

The year 1996 is written MCMXCVI. Reading left to right that is M (1000) + CM (900) + XC (90) + V (5) + I (1), added together to reach 1996.

Why does MCMXCVI start with MCM?

MCM is the numeral for 1900, and every year from 1900 to 1999 opens with it. The letters after it, XCVI, carry the remaining 96.
